THE people of Netherthird, Craigens and Skerrington are being urged to play their part in shaping the area’s future.

Letters and surveys have been sent out looking to local resident looking for their input into the way forward for the community.

They have until next week to fill out their forms before the results are collated and the group can move forward.

A spokesperson said: “There are exciting times for the community and we need 40 per cent of people to fill out their forms - otherwise we can’t move forward together with this.

“The Local Action Plan will help improve our villages and attract funding for different projects highlighted by the Community Action Plan.” The Local Action Plans are being promoted by East Ayrshire and Mauchline, New Cumnock and Cronberry, Logan and Lugar have all announced their exciting proposals over the next five years.” The results will be revealed in the Chronicle when they become available.
